These are five (5) applications filed under section 67 of the Employment Standards Act (“the Act”).
Counsel for the responding party (“the employer”) requests that the matter be adjourned and rescheduled to accommodate her maternity leave. She is available from the week of March 11, 2002 on. All parties with the exception of one of the applicants consents to the extension.
Having regard to these circumstances, the Board is prepared to grant the adjournment. It is most efficient for these cases to be heard together and the majority of the applicants and the Ministry of Labour are prepared to allow the matter to be delayed.
These matters are referred to the Registrar to schedule for hearing together as soon as practicable after March 11, 2002.
